Project Manager Sr. - Construction jobs in Fresno, CA

Project Manager Sr. - Construction directs construction project management planning and execution processes to meet project design requirements, schedules, and organizational financial objectives. Provides overall strategic governance for projects by establishing standards, processes, and tools for effective project management throughout the project lifecycle. Being a Project Manager Sr. - Construction uses comprehensive knowledge of construction processes and operations to set project productivity and quality targets. Monitors project milestones, change orders, and technical status reports. Additionally, Project Manager Sr. - Construction manages strategic client relationships and establishes clear lines of communication. Responds to escalated project issues that may impede project delivery and coordinates solutions. Analyzes project metrics to identify weaknesses or problems and propose operational improvements and cost savings for future projects. Requ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a director. The Project Manager Sr. - Construction manages subordinate staff in the day-to-day performance of their jobs. True first level manager. Ensures that project/department milestones/goals are met and adhering to approved budgets. Has full authority for personnel actions. To be a Project Manager Sr. - Construction typically requires 5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. 1-3 years supervisory experience may be required.     A PM's role is essential to the success of a project during construction phases. PMs are engaged with our sales and estimating teams early on in the project in and are ultimately responsible in understanding and carrying out the construction of their assigned project. They are responsible for overseeing project organization, budgeting, scheduling, and execution. More specifically, the PM has complete responsibility to assure that any project assigned to them is completed to contracted specifications, in a safe manner, within both time frame and construction budget allotted.

    75% of our projects come from existing clients who come back to us time and time again knowing they will receive the highest quality and service from us. PMs are responsible for building and maintain these positive client relationships throughout their project; striving for 100% customer satisfaction. No one else in company has a greater potential to affect the client’s attitude toward SPAN.

    This position requires periodic travel to meet with our clients and other team members.

    PMs work closely with estimators, the client, client representatives, subcontractors, assigned administrative assistant, onsite superintendents and consultants surrounding the project.     Essential Functions:

    • Consistently works towards position goals outlined above
    • Reviews and thoroughly evaluates contract, project scope, and other hand-off materials from the Pre-Construction Services Team to ensure a complete and comprehensive understanding of Owner contract, project budget and schedule
    • Identifies SPAN- and Owner-driven priorities, and align with operational goals of the project
    • is investigatory in order to understand the full scope of work and any project-specific considerations that have cost impacts
    • Reviews architectural drawings for understanding and clarifies any conflicting information
    • Reviews Pre-Engineered Building and vendor drawings for understanding of materials provided and installation requirements, clarifying any conflicting information
    • Reviews subsequently issued drawings or project revisions; any pertinent changes must be accounted for with a change order to the client and in turn, conveyed to vendors/subcontractors/field personnel
    • Partners with Controller regarding status of required local/state business license; ensures licenses are obtained
    • Requisitions all labor, equipment and materials necessary to complete the project: work with engineering personnel as deemed necessary to finalize the material orders and to establishes guidelines for the execution of the engineering work required for the project
    • Writes the necessary subcontracts and purchase orders needed, as needed, if not already executed by the Pre-Construction Services Team
    • Ensures subcontractor insurance and safety requirements and/documentation are provided and adhered to per contract
    • Conducts or attends a preconstruction meeting with the Owner and Subcontractors to ensure that everyone understands the requirements and schedule for the project
    • Prepares progress billings in a timely manner in compliance with the requirements of the prime contract
    • Reviews and authorizes vendor and subcontractor invoices, considering project budget
    • Upon final completion of the project, walks the job with the Client for approval and projects feedback, receives and prioritizes completion of punch list items
    • Provides critical and strategic input for potential options to enable the best chance of project success
    • Prepares cost analysis in computer by recapitulating material, labor, equipment, subcontractor, and overhead costs incurred in the installation of items

Fresno (/ˈfrɛznoʊ/ FREZ-noh; Spanish for "ash tree") is a city in California, United States, and the county seat of Fresno County. It covers about 112 square miles (290 km2) in the center of the San Joaquin Valley, the southern portion of California's Central Valley. Named for the abundant ash trees lining the San Joaquin River, Fresno was founded in 1872 as a railway station of the Central Pacific Railroad before it was incorporated in 1885.
